Expression vector of ANKR1domain of mouse Ankrd27.
Clone info. | Expression vector of ANKR1domain of mouse ankyrin repeat domain 27 (Ankrd27) tagged with T7-GST at N-terminus, EF1 promoter. |
---|---|
Vector backbone | pEF-T7 (plasmid) |
Selectable markers | Amp^r. |
Gene/insert name | mouse Ankrd27 cDNA |
Reference of insert sequence | AB455262 (DDBJ accession number) |
Depositor|Developer | Fukuda, Mitsunori | |
